545 E 38th St #E012, Paterson, NJ 07504 is a studio, 1 bathroom, 500 sqft apartment in Eastside Park Historic District. More recently, it was listed as a rental in August 2024 with an asking price of $1,349 per month. That rental listing was removed on September 13, 2024.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ate rent is $1,432/month.
